Targetry of MoO3 on a copper substrate for the no-carrier-added 94mTc production via94Mo(p,n)94mTc reaction
94m,Tc was produced ,via,nat,Mo(p,x,n),94m,Tc reaction. Deposition of MoO,3, on Cu substrate was carried out ,via, two special sedimentation methods for the production of ,94m,Tc. The 533 mg of MoO,3, 600 µL of collodium (nitrocellulose) and 3 mL of acetone were used to prepare a MoO,3, layer of 11.69 cm,2, and 45.81 mg·cm,-2,. Also, a MoO,3, layer was prepared by 533 mg of MoO,3, 71.188 mg of methylcellulose and 4 mL of water. The targets were checked by SEM and thermal shock test.
